The first-of-its-kind in-depth bacterial evolutionary map could pave the way for the development of precision treatments for certain antibiotic-resistant infections, such as urinary tract infections.
Researchers at the Wellcome Sanger Institute, the University of Oslo, UiT The Arctic University of Norway, and their collaborators, have developed a new way of using large-scale long-read sequencing data to investigate circular genetic structures called plasmids in the most commonly studied…
